- Started working on separation power and Bethe-Bloch fit (left: GPU CF, right: NN)






- Caveats: Way to few electrons in either case to make a reliable fit: Need to generate more data
- Plot 1: dE/dx spectra with default LHC18b parameterization. Only MIP scaling changed from 50 (GPU CF) to 60 (NN), otherwise the parameters are the same.
- Plot 2: Separation power at ~MIP (p = 0.3 to 0.4 GeV/c). Gaussian fits were constrained (at least the electron fit, red). But pion band width (relative dE/dx resolution) is improved from 12.6% (GPU CF) to 11.5% (NN), to be confirmed with more data.
- Plot 3: Default parameterization still looks a lot healthier than the fit since electrons cannot yet constrain the Fermi plateau (more data).
